Window Sill Replacement in Kansas City, KS
Window sill replacement services involve removing and installing new sills to improve the appearance, functionality, and durability of windows. This project typically covers both interior and exterior sills, addressing issues such as rot, damage, or outdated styles. Property owners often seek this service to enhance curb appeal, prevent water infiltration, or prepare for window upgrades. Before requesting window sill replacement, homeowners usually want to understand the materials available, the scope of work involved, and how the new sills will complement the existing architecture of the property.
Many property owners inquire about the best materials for durability and maintenance, such as wood, vinyl, or composite options. It's also common to want clarity on the process, including whether existing sills need removal or if repairs can be made to salvage the current structure. Understanding the potential impact on window operation and the overall aesthetics of the space helps homeowners make informed decisions. Properly replacing window sills can contribute to the longevity of windows and improve the overall appearance of a home.

Window Sill Replacement Questions
What are signs that window sills need replacement? Visible damage, rotting wood, or peeling paint can indicate the need for sill replacement.
Can replacing window sills improve energy efficiency? Yes, properly installed sills help seal windows and can reduce drafts and heat loss.
What types of materials are used for window sill replacement? Common options include wood, vinyl, and composite materials, chosen based on durability and style preferences.
Is window sill replacement necessary during window upgrades? It can be beneficial if the existing sills are damaged or outdated, ensuring a proper fit and function for new windows.
